Dasbodh Jayanti is observed in Magh month. Dasbodh means ‘advice
to the disciple.’ It is believed that this Advaita Vedanta spiritual text in
Marathi was first narrated on this day. Dasbodh Jayanti 2024 date is February 18.
Sant Samarth Ramdas orally narrated Dasbodh to his disciple,
Kalyan Swami. It is presented in the format of a conversation between a Guru
and disciple.
Dasbodh advocates both Bhakti (devotion) method and Jnana (knowledge)
method for attaining liberation.
Dasbodh Jayanti is annually observed on Magh Shukla Paksha
Navami Tithi or the ninth day during the waxing phase of moon in Magh month as
per traditional Hindu lunar calendar followed in Maharashtra.
